Vision X-Coupe demonstrates the development of the "KODO - Soul of Motion" design idea. It is equipped with a plug-in hybrid system that combines a rotary turbo engine with an electric motor and a battery.
The maximum system power is 510 hp. Moreover, the electric motor mode range reaches 160 km, and when operating from the rotary engine, it increases to 800 km.

Besides, thanks to the combination of carbon-neutral fuel derived from algae and the proprietary CO2 capture technology "Mazda Mobile Carbon Capture," the car helps reduce CO2 emissions into the atmosphere as driving time increases.

Mazda already uses a rotary-electric powertrain in the MX-30 crossover and previously stated that it plans to launch the 370 hp two-door Iconic SP coupe with similar technology into production.
However, unlike the mid-engine SP, in this new four-door concept, the engine is mounted at the front, under a long hood.
The length of the Vision X-Coupe is 5.05 meters, and the wheelbase is 3.08 meters.
